In the world of technology and engineering, the term front connection type refers to a specific method of connecting components in a system where the connections are made at the front side of the device or equipment. This design choice is often made for reasons of accessibility and ease of use. For instance, in consumer electronics like televisions or computer monitors, having ports and connectors located at the front allows users to easily plug in devices without needing to reach behind the unit. This is particularly beneficial in crowded spaces where back access might be limited. The advantages of the front connection type are numerous. Firstly, it enhances user experience by making it easier to connect and disconnect devices. Users can quickly switch between different inputs, such as HDMI or USB, without the hassle of moving the equipment or struggling to find the right port. This is especially important in environments like classrooms or conference rooms, where presentations often require quick changes between laptops or other media devices. Moreover, the front connection type can contribute to a cleaner and more organized setup. By having all connections on the front, users can manage cables more effectively, reducing clutter and making it easier to identify which cable goes where. This organization is not only aesthetically pleasing but also functional, as it minimizes the risk of accidentally unplugging the wrong device. However, there are also some challenges associated with the front connection type. For example, while it provides easy access, it may expose the connectors to more wear and tear compared to those located at the back. Frequent plugging and unplugging can lead to damage over time, necessitating more frequent repairs or replacements. Manufacturers must therefore consider the durability of the connectors when designing products with this type of connection. Additionally, the front connection type may limit design options for certain devices. For instance, in compact electronics, space is often at a premium. Designers must carefully plan how to integrate front-facing connections without compromising the overall aesthetic or functionality of the device. This balancing act can sometimes lead to compromises that affect either usability or design integrity. In conclusion, the front connection type is a significant aspect of modern design in technology and engineering. It offers numerous benefits in terms of user accessibility, organization, and convenience, making it a popular choice among manufacturers. However, it also presents challenges that need to be addressed to ensure longevity and maintain the aesthetic appeal of devices. As technology continues to evolve, the importance of effective connection methods, such as the front connection type, will remain a critical consideration for designers and engineers alike.
